Ticket #4182: Notifier fan-out backpressure borked after creds expired. The Pulsewing dispatcher started queueing everything once its key to the Fanline relay lapsed, so retries piled up and the backpressure valve never released. Future maintainers: rotation is quarterly, but the renewal cron on the Oatgrove box silently skips if the relay is mid-deploy. Check the queue depth gauge first, then re-auth. For local testing against the staging relay, use the key below.

service key, fawip-bajef: kto11_Qt5wZK9vdNC

Account recovery for the Murrowhall Audio Guide: when a visitor profile is locked, plugins must call the recovery endpoint with the exhibit-scope token, then wait for the grace window to expire. Never reset credentials directly; the core service handles that. If the recovery endpoint itself rejects your plugin, reauthorize it using the recovery passphrase below.

unlock words, yawig-kagef: gordor-holvan-ulaael-pramir-ulaiel-tamdor

Subject: On-call handover — Quillgate dark mode

Hi Soren,

Handing over the open dark-mode ticket for the Bramblewick admin dashboard. The theme toggle now persists via a signed cookie; I verified the flag can't be tampered with client-side, but the security review of the new CSS injection guard is still pending. Watch for CSP violations in the theming sandbox overnight. If the reviewer needs clarification, they should write to the address below.

alerts address for kajog-tadup: druox@plorvanet.internal